![]() Job Action Day is a reminder that it takes action to get into work that fits and grow and change with the business whether yours or someone else’s. You create your career story. Take action to make your story exciting and interesting so that a new adventure awaits you every day. Job: the work that has value Action: movement or exciting activity Day: time constraint Job Action Day reminds us that doing work that we value takes action––getting up, getting out and doing something––within a reasonable time limit. It’s easy to feel stuck, overwhelmed, or overly stressed about change. When you get that unsettled feeling in your gut and know you need to take action you may be looking for a job, wanting to change the way you work, or you may want to work for yourself. As you sit in front of your computer contemplating change; get up and get out.
Your profile is your story that ignites your call to action. You know what you want to do and you can’t wait to write it down. When you write down your goals and plans, you set them in motion in your body and brain. Once your juices are flowing and you are ready for action you will start on the path to your new success. Your path may change as new opportunities arise. You can plan for and take advantage of unexpected opportunities or Planned Happenstance; the key is to take action!
